Article Excerpt It can be difficult enough to have an adequate supply of physicians in urban areas of the state where doctors have access to the latest technology at large hospitals. In rural areas, there simply aren't enough doctors to go around.
"In Mississippi's rural areas, access to healthcare--especially primary care physicians--is a growing concern," said Shawn Zehnder Lea, vice president for strategic communications, Mississippi Hospital Association. "University of North Carolina researchers have found that only 11% of physicians nationally are located in rural areas, but 20% of the U.S. is considered rural. And Mississippi is largely a rural population."
In 2004, Merritt, Hawkins & Associates, a healthcare staffing and consulting firm, published, "Will the Last Physician in America Please Turn off the Lights? A Look at America's Looming Doctor Shortage." Lea said the authors predict there will be a shortage of 90,000 to 200,000 physicians and that average wait times for medical specialties are likely to increase dramatically beyond the current range of two to five weeks.
"Even before Hurricane Katrina, Mississippi was facing a shortage of physicians," Lea said. "Findings presented in a 2003 white paper by the Health Policy Research Center at Mississippi State University indicate an 'extant physician shortage will become more severe.'...
